昨天改一个jsp页面,想在js中加一个switch语句,一直没成功。今天上午耐心尝试着,终于成功了。
代码如下:
function disSection(){
var len=document.getElementById("len").value;
switch(len){
case "4"
:
alert("i am here");
document.getElementById("option4").style.display="inline";
break;
case "5"
:
document.getElementById("option4").style.display="inline";
document.getElementById("option5").style.display="inline";
break;
case "6"
:
document.getElementById("option4").style.display="inline";
document.getElementById("option5").style.display="inline";
document.getElementById("option6").style.display="inline";
break;
default:
break;
};
}
window.onload=disSection;
注意
:
1 case 后的如果不是变量需加双引号""
2 swich结束的花扩符外要加分号;
分享到:
相关推荐
Javasscript表格列排序 Javasscript表格列排序 Javasscript表格列排序
这篇文档《JavaScript程序设计-JavasScript类型之undefined.pdf》主要探讨的是JavaScript中的Undefined类型及其使用。 首先,Undefined类型只有一个值,那就是undefined。当我们在JavaScript中使用`var`关键字声明...
在电商模板中,JavaScript处理用户交互、数据验证、异步请求(如API调用获取商品信息)等功能。结合Vue,JavaScript可以实现复杂的业务逻辑和动画效果,增强用户体验。 【CSS】 CSS(Cascading Style Sheets)用于...
1. **JavaScript基础**:书中首先介绍JavaScript的基础知识,如变量、数据类型(包括原始类型和引用类型)、运算符、语句结构(如条件语句和循环语句)以及函数的使用,这些都是编写JavaScript程序的基石。...
JavaScript 的基础知识包括变量、数据类型、控制流(如条件语句和循环)、函数、对象和类等。高级特性如闭包、原型链、模块化(CommonJS、ES6 模块)和异步编程(Promise、async/await)也是现代 JavaScript 开发者...
本文将深入探讨JavaScript编程艺术及其在DOM操作中的应用,并结合提供的源码进行详细解析。 首先,JavaScript编程艺术的核心在于理解其动态特性和面向对象编程的概念。JavaScript是一种解释型、弱类型的语言,它...
- **应用场景**:通常用于监测图片加载过程中的中断情况,可以在事件处理函数中执行相应的清理工作或者提示用户。 #### 2. `onactivate` - **定义**:当对象设置为活动元素时触发。 - **应用场景**:可用于跟踪用户...
在每个回合中,玩家掷骰子的次数与他希望的次数相同。 每个结果都会加到他的ROUND分数中 但是,如果玩家掷出1,则他的全部回合得分都会丢失。 之后,轮到下一个玩家了 玩家可以选择“保留”,这意味着他的回合得分会...
该存储库目前正在建设中。 小心轻放。 设置 load ( "@bazel_tools//tools/build_defs/repo:git.bzl" , "git_repository" ) git_repository ( name = "rules_javascript" , branch = "master" , urls = [ ...
在这个项目中,我们关注的是使用JavaScript实现的版本。JavaScript是一种广泛用于网页和网络应用开发的编程语言,尤其适用于前端交互。在这个练习中,开发者通过编写JavaScript代码,创建了一个可以在浏览器环境中...
2. **循环与控制结构**:`for`、`while`循环和`if`条件语句在解决Project Euler问题中扮演了重要角色,它们用于迭代、判断和分支逻辑。 3. **数组和集合操作**:许多Euler问题涉及序列处理,JavaScript的数组方法如...
一个愚蠢的JavasScript捆绑程序,用于单页应用程序,比您和我都笨。 通常,您不会直接使用此软件包,而dumber旨在通过。 使用“ makes”通过dumber bundler创建新的JS SPA项目(Aurelia / React / Vue)。 npx ...
不推荐使用这个库试图解决太多问题,因此我将spring动画分成了 。 对于补间,我强烈建议 。 npm install flux-tween 例子创建通过调用动画flux.tween()或弹簧通过调用flux.spring() 使用to和from之间的值进行动画...
在“arcgis server for java简单例子”中,我们可以学习如何通过Java API与ArcGIS Server进行交互,创建和发布地图服务。这个简单的示例将涵盖以下几个关键知识点: 1. **ArcGIS Server安装与配置**:首先,我们...
在JavaScript中,可以定义一个二维数组来表示游戏板的状态,数组的每个元素对应游戏板上的一个单元格,值可能是空、'X'或'O',分别代表空位、玩家X和玩家O的标记。每当玩家点击一个单元格,JavaScript会更新对应的...
节拍报纸这是我构建的一个应用程序,用于模拟名为 Beats Newspaper 的报纸。 在首页上,我尝试了特别有趣的 css3 动画。 该项目的主要目的是加深对 Angular 和 Angular-ui 的理解。安装说明: 克隆仓库 python -m ...
对于前端vue框架中JavasScript应用程序的模块打包器webpack搭建vue项目的具体步骤和详细的介绍
康威在 HTML5/JavasScript 中的生命游戏在这个模拟中,活细胞被表示为白板上的黑色瓷砖。 一个细胞的存活仅取决于它在当前一代中存活的相邻细胞的数量。 当板更新时,计算每个单元格的存活率并创建下一代单元格。 ...